API Managers are tools that provide a centralized platform for managing and securing APIs (Application Programming Interfaces). They enable organizations to control access to their APIs, monitor usage, enforce security policies, and analyze performance. Common uses include: exposing backend systems as APIs for mobile apps or partner integrations, managing API traffic to prevent overload, and securing APIs against unauthorized access or malicious attacks.
